World Day for the Poor A special Collection for the World Day for the Poor takes place on Sunday 19 November. The money will go to the Fife Furniture Project, which is run by the Society of St Vincent de Paul. It has helped hundreds of people across the Archdiocese, many in desperate situations, by providing basic furniture and white goods for their home.
